Understanding this circumference around a circle might seem straightforward, but this involves some key formula. To find the distance of the circle's edge, you'll need to know a radius or diameter. The equation is C = 2πr (where 'r' stands for the radius) alternatively, C = πd (using the diameter 'd'). Simply substitute the values into the this formula and you can effortlessly calculate the circumference. Do not forgetting that π (pi) is 3.14159!

Understanding Circumference: A Quick Calculation Guide

Knowing how to find the perimeter of a sphere is a useful skill. The measurement around a round shape, or its circumference , can be quickly discovered using a simple formula. You’ll require the value of pi (π), which is roughly 3.14159, and the radius of the object . For a perfectly round object, the calculation is: Circumference = 2 * π * radius. Alternatively, if you have the width , which is two times the radius, you can implement the formula: Circumference = π * diameter. Here’s a brief summary:

  • Radius is one-half the diameter.
  • Diameter is twice the radius.
  • The calculation provides the circumference of the object .

The Circumference Tool

Calculating the circumference a circle can be easy with a circumference calculator . The basic calculation is C = 2πr, where 'C' denotes the perimeter and 'r' stands for the radius . Alternatively, you can use C = πd, where 'd' refers to the extent – the distance through the round form . Let’s examine a couple of cases: if a disc’s radius equals 5 units, its perimeter would be approximately 31.42 units (2 * π * 5). Similarly, if the width of a round shape is 10 units, the roundness would be around 31.42 units (π * 10). Understanding these approaches allows you to efficiently figure out the perimeter of any rounded object .
